Transaction 34b2c90bbd8bf564de16244a9eb7cf1a2541ee81b7e74b251b1925bff2fa1a8c
1 Input
2 Outputs
- 34b2c90bbd8bf564de16244a9eb7cf1a2541ee81b7e74b251b1925bff2fa1a8c:0
- 34b2c90bbd8bf564de16244a9eb7cf1a2541ee81b7e74b251b1925bff2fa1a8c:1
value 524743
address 1P6Lu2HYy5nyhsAq11vsmWW3LLPRcJMjCA
value 556662
address 1Jt5DgxvTxsadCDLsDwHwvFX81uPYkax6X